What is a key-programmer?
A car key programer is a device used to reset a vehicle's system and permit the creation of new keys. It is a specific piece of equipment that can be purchased at a variety of auto parts stores and locksmiths. These tools are designed to help repair shops and DIY customers create replacement keys, restore data from immobilizers and more. They usually connect to the OBD II port of the car, allowing them work quickly and easily.
The cost of a car key programmer is based on the make and model of the vehicle, and the location in which the procedure is executed. For instance, certain vehicles may require only just a few minutes for an auto locksmith key programming near me expert to program, while other may require more intricate procedures, which include the use of EEPROM programming.
Certain car makers like Mercedes have locked down their system to ensure that only dealers can create new keys. This means that they have developed an arrangement that requires the use of a particular software program and a keycode that is only accessible through the dealership. This procedure is risky and can cause serious damage to the vehicle if it is not executed correctly.
A professional locksmith is able to program the car key fob, or transponder key programmer chip within only a few minutes. they can also copy the new remote head for some cars. They can also use an electronic system to reset the car's system should it be necessary. These systems are designed to safeguard the electronics of the car from external interference and block access by unauthorized persons.
While you may be able to reprogram your key fob at home, it is not recommended unless you have prior experience with electronics and soldering. You can buy a basic key programmer on the internet for a few dollars, or you can buy a more advanced model that can perform many more functions beyond changing the programming of keys for cars.
Some cars have a token system in place that only allows the computer to be programmed with one token per day. This means that the locksmith will need to purchase additional tokens for each attempt to program that are included in the total cost of the service.

How do I find a reliable key programmer?
There are numerous car key programmer models available on the market. Each comes with specific features and specifications. The kind of car key programmers you select will depend on the budget you have set and what you intend to use it for. Some car key programmers are more advanced than others and require a higher degree of technical expertise to operate. Certain of these models are only available to dealers or locksmiths, and could cost thousands of dollars.
If you're looking for a car key programer that works on a variety of vehicles, look into the Autel MaxilM IM508 programer. This is a high end car key programmer that offers OE-level diagnostics. It also comes with a robust tool set to work with smart keys, and ECU programming. This tool is expensive and therefore not recommended for mechanics who are at home. However, it could be worth it in an environment that is professional.
It is important to remember that reprogramming your car is a complicated process that requires special expertise and equipment. Reprogramming a car key without this experience could lead to costly electronics damage and may even render your vehicle undriveable.
It is also important to note that some car brands require that you have two working keys to create third. You should consult your owner's manual or online to find out the steps needed to make the third key for your vehicle.
